Apple A10X Fusion has a maximum frequency of 1.30 GHz. 6 Cores. Power consumption of 8 W. Released in Q2/2017.

Intel Core i5-8260U has a maximum frequency of 1.60 GHz. 4 Cores. Power consumption of 15 W. Released in Q4/2019.
